SysUnit is a JUnit framework for distributed testing, system testing and integration testing. SysUnit is ideal for testing highly distributed software such as clusters of web applications, web services or MOM based software

JMX4Ant provides the ability to interact with JMX MBeans from Ant. Supports several popular JMX implementations and J2EE servers including JBoss and BEA WebLogic Server.
Data Evolution for Java. Finch is a Data Transformation System based on JDBC and other Java blessed specifications. Finch is based on a component task architecture allowing users to create complex data manipulation jobs.

Fragit provides high level ant tasks in order greatly simplify the Java build process. These tasks can be chained together in order to painlessly switch between different deployment strategies - eg 3-tier for release versus 2-tier for development.

This project focuses on the integration between Macs and SMB/CIFS networks. The primary goal will be to get a complete port of the Samba package to Mac OS X. Besides that we will try to create tools to uses these services.
The MathForge Application Environment provides users a broad range of Java-based math tools (calculation, visualization, presentation and communication via MathML) and allows developers to leverage existing code while extending MathForge.

This project aims to build a full featured C++ (and possibly Python) library and associated tools which facilitate building Artificial Life simulations in a distributed environment.
The project discusses an architecture, prototype implementation and test tools for wireless scheduling using currently available hardware (e.g. 802.11 WLAN). It is based on a patch/new scheduler for the Linux 2.4.X kernels and extensions for the tc tools.
eManTools is a set of tools, which includes such things as a rule-based log file processor, a NT EventLog to BSD Syslog forwarder, monitoring scripts, a web based console, and integration and customizations for commercial products like Tivoli.
